Hagia Sophia
Hagia Sophia’s origins date back to the 6th century, when Byzantine Emperor Justinian I commissioned its construction as a grand Christian cathedral.
Rec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, the structure is renowned for its stunning Byzantine and Ottoman architectural elements. Its massive dome, which reaches over 180 feet in height, is an engineering marvel that has inspired architects for centuries.
After serving as a church for nearly 1,000 years, Hagia Sophia was converted into a mosque in the 15th century and then into a museum in the 20th century.
Today, visitors can marvel at the building’s intricate mosaics, frescoes, and calligraphic displays that showcase its rich multi-faith history.
Blue Mosque
Constructed in the early 17th century, the Blue Mosque is one of Istanbul’s most iconic landmarks. Officially named the Sultan Ahmed Mosque, it’s famous for its striking blue İznik tiles and six towering minarets.

Topkapi Palace
Topkapi Palace stands as a testament to the grandeur and power of the Ottoman Empire. This historical landmark was the primary residence of the Ottoman sultans for nearly 400 years.
Visitors can explore the palace’s stunning architecture, which blends Byzantine, Islamic, and Ottoman elements. The palace grounds house impressive structures like the Harem, the Treasury, and the Sacred Relics.
Guests can marvel at the intricate İznik tiles, ornate furnishings, and priceless artifacts that showcase the opulence of the Ottoman court.
With its rich history and captivating beauty, Topkapi Palace offers a glimpse into the fascinating legacy of the Ottoman dynasty.

Grand Bazaar
What makes the Grand Bazaar one of Istanbul’s top attractions? This massive covered market boasts nearly 4,000 shops, offering an unparalleled shopping experience.
Visitors can explore a treasure trove of antiques, jewelry, carpets, leatherware, and souvenirs under the bazaar’s iconic domed roofs.
With its rich history and vibrant atmosphere, the Grand Bazaar provides a glimpse into the heart of the city’s commercial and cultural traditions.

What Is the Dress Code for Visiting the Mosques?
When visiting mosques, modest dress is required. Visitors should cover their arms and legs, and women should cover their hair with a scarf. Revealing or inappropriate attire is not permitted.
Can I Take Photographs Inside the Sites?
Visitors are generally allowed to take photographs inside the sites, including the Hagia Sophia and Blue Mosque. However, they should be respectful and avoid disrupting ongoing religious activities. Photography may be restricted in certain areas or during certain times.
